Die Klauenkupplung dient zum Einrücken ganzer Wellenstränge sowie von Triebwerksteilen im Zustand der Ruhe. Die Kupplung hat gegenüber den bisherigen den Vorteil, daß sie in jeder Lage eingerückt werden kann, während das bisher nur dann vorgenommen werden konnte, wenn Klaue und Lücke genau aufeinander paßten; es mußte also das Vorgelege so lange gedreht werden,The claw clutch is used to engage entire shaft trains as well as engine parts in a state of rest. The clutch has the advantage over the previous ones that it can be engaged in any position can, whereas up to now this could only be done if the claw and gap matched exactly; it should so the additional gear can be rotated for so long

ίο bis diese Lage hergestellt war. Der auf der Welle verschiebbare Teil, die Kupplungsmuffe a, welche zum Ein- und Ausrücken dient, ist jnit einer oder zwei,Nuten versehen, die ein teilweises D/ehen zulassen. Außerdem sindίο until this situation was established. The part that can be moved on the shaft, the coupling sleeve a, which is used for engaging and disengaging, is provided with one or two grooves that allow partial dilation. Also are

Federn δ angebracht, die die Kupplungsmuffe stets in die alte Lage zurückdrehen. Stoßen beim Einrücken die Klauen aufeinander, so bewirkt die zugespitzte Form derselben, daß letztere aneinander — unter teilweisem Drehen jder Kupplungsmuffe α — vorbeigleiten, bis die Klauen sich in die Lücken hineinschieben. Bei dieser Bewegung wird die Feder b gespannt, da diese einmal gegen den Nutenkeil und einmal gegen die Stiftschraube c anliegt, welche mit der Kupplungsmuffe a verbunden ist. Beim Ausrücken wird die Kupplungsmuffe durch die gespannte Feder in ihre alte Lage zurückgedreht. Der Ausschlag der Kupplungsmuffe muß mindestens so groß sein wie die Teilung t der Klauen. Die gewählte Anordnung ermöglicht ein Ausschlagen der Kupplungsmuffe α nach jeder Seite hin um den Betrag 1J21, jedoch kann die Anordnung der Klauen auch so getroffen werden, daß die Kupplung nur nach einer Seite um den Betrag t ausschlägt. Die Schrauben d verhindern beim Verschieben der Kupplungsmuffe ein Herausspringen der Feder b. Springs δ attached, which always turn the coupling sleeve back into its old position. If the claws collide when engaging, the tapered shape of the same causes the latter to slide past each other - with partial turning of each coupling sleeve α - until the claws slide into the gaps. During this movement, the spring b is tensioned because it rests once against the keyway and once against the stud screw c , which is connected to the coupling sleeve a . When disengaging, the coupling sleeve is turned back into its old position by the tensioned spring. The deflection of the coupling sleeve must be at least as large as the pitch t of the claws. The chosen arrangement enables the coupling sleeve α to deflect to each side by the amount 1 J 2 1, but the arrangement of the claws can also be made so that the coupling deflects only to one side by the amount t. The screws d prevent the spring b from jumping out when the coupling sleeve is moved.

Claims (1)

Patent-Anspruch :Patent claim: Klauenkupplung mit zugespitzten Klauen zum Einrücken der Kupplung im Zustande der Ruhe, dadurch gekennzeichnet, daß die verschiebbare, durch Nut und Feder mit der Welle verbundene Kupplungshälfte (a) um einen gewissen Winkel drehbar auf der Welle angeordnet ist und durch eine Bügelfeder (b). in einer bestimmten Lage auf der Welle gehalten wird, so daß ein Einrücken der Kupplung ohne vorherige Drehung des mit der Kupplung verbundenen Triebwerks auch dann möglich ist, wenn Klaue und Lücke nicht genau aufeinander passen.Claw coupling with tapered claws for engaging the coupling in the state of rest, characterized in that the sliding coupling half (a) connected to the shaft by tongue and groove is arranged on the shaft rotatable through a certain angle and by a bow spring (b). is held in a certain position on the shaft, so that an engagement of the clutch without prior rotation of the drive unit connected to the clutch is possible even if the claw and gap do not exactly match one another.
